Multi-Layered Abstraction-Based Controller Synthesis for Continuous-Time Systems

被引:38
|
作者
Hsu, Kyle [1 ]
Majumdar, Rupak [2 ]
Mallik, Kaushik [2 ]
Schmuck, Anne-Kathrin [2 ]
机构
[1] Univ Toronto, Toronto, ON, Canada
[2] MPI SWS, Kaiserslautern, Germany
关键词
MULTIRESOLUTION APPROACH;
D O I
10.1145/3178126.3178143
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
We present multi-layered abstraction-based controller synthesis, which extends standard abstraction-based controller synthesis (ABCS) algorithms for continuous-time control systems by simultaneously maintaining several "layers" of abstract systems with decreasing precision. The resulting abstract multi-layered controller uses the coarsest abstraction whenever this is feasible, and dynamically adjusts the precision-by moving to a more precise abstraction and back to a coarser abstraction-based on the structure of the given control problem. Abstract multi-layered controllers can be refined to controllers with non-uniform resolution using feedback refinement relations established between each abstract layer and the concrete system, resulting in a sound ABCS method. We provide multi-layered controller synthesis algorithms for reachability, safety, and generalized Buchi specifications; our approach can be generalized to any omega-regular objective. Our algorithms are complete relative to single-layered synthesis on the finest layer. We empirically demonstrate that multi-layered synthesis can outperform standard (single-layer) ABCS algorithms on a number of examples, despite the additional cost of constructing multiple abstract systems.
引用
收藏
页码:120 / 129
页数:10
相关论文
共 50 条
  • [11] On Abstraction-Based Controller Design With Output Feedback
    Majumdar, Rupak
    Ozay, Necmiye
    Schmuck, Anne-Kathrin
    PROCEEDINGS OF THE 23RD INTERNATIONAL CONFERENCE ON HYBRID SYSTEMS: COMPUTATION AND CONTROL (HSCC2020) (PART OF CPS-IOT WEEK), 2020,
  • [12] Abstraction of Continuous-Time Systems Based on Feedback Controllers and Mixed Monotonicity
    Sinyakov, Vladimir
    Girard, Antoine
    I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2023, 68 (08) : 4508 - 4522
  • [13] Controller Synthesis of Continuous-Time Piecewise Linear Systems Based on Piecewise Lyapunov Functions
    Qiu Jianbin
    Feng Gang
    Gao Huijun
    2011 30TH CHINESE CONTROL CONFERENCE (CCC), 2011, : 6481 - 6486
  • [14] Compositional abstraction-based synthesis for networks of stochastic switched systems
    Lavaei, Abolfazl
    Soudjani, Sadegh
    Zamani, Majid
    AUTOMATICA, 2020, 114
  • [15] H∞ controller synthesis of uncertain piecewise continuous-time linear systems
    Zhu, Y
    Li, DQ
    Feng, G
    IEE PROCEEDINGS-CONTROL THEORY AND APPLICATIONS, 2005, 152 (05): : 513 - 519
  • [16] Stability Analysis and Controller Synthesis for Continuous-Time Linear Stochastic Systems
    Pushpak, Sai
    Diwadkar, Amit
    Vaidya, Umesh
    2015 54TH IEEE CONFERENCE ON DECISION AND CONTROL (CDC), 2015, : 3792 - 3797
  • [17] ABSTRACTION-BASED VERIFICATION AND SYNTHESIS FOR PROGNOSIS OF DISCRETE EVENT SYSTEMS
    Yokotani, Misato
    Kondo, Tetsuya
    Takai, Shigemasa
    ASIAN JOURNAL OF CONTROL, 2016, 18 (04) : 1279 - 1288
  • [18] Abstraction-Based Interaction Model for Synthesis
    Peleg, Hila
    Itzhaky, Shachar
    Shoham, Sharon
    VERIFICATION, MODEL CHECKING, AND ABSTRACT INTERPRETATION (VMCAI 2018), 2018, 10747 : 382 - 405
  • [19] Abstraction-based Motion Coordination Control for Multi-Robot Systems
    Pan, Zhuo-Rui
    Ren, Wei
    Sun, Xi-Ming
    2023 62ND IEEE CONFERENCE ON DECISION AND CONTROL, CDC, 2023, : 6966 - 6971
  • [20] The Research of Distributed Suboptimal Controller for Continuous-time Multi-agent Systems
    Li, Xiaoqian
    Zhang, Fangfang
    Wang, Wei
    2017 CHINESE AUTOMATION CONGRESS (CAC), 2017, : 5648 - 5653